Tampa Bay Rays' 2-0 series lead over the Toronto Blue Jays, secured by 5-1 and 4-3 wins at pitcher-friendly Tropicana Field, underscores their home momentum and recent hitting surge, with Yandy Díaz batting .314 and five RBI over the last 10 games. Toronto's starting rotation remains decimated by injuries—José Berríos (elbow stress fracture), Max Scherzer (forearm tendinitis), and Shane Bieber (elbow inflammation) on the IL—forcing reliance on Patrick Corbin (1-0, 3.65 ERA) against Rays ace Shane McClanahan. George Springer's return to DH from a leg injury bolsters the lineup, but road struggles and bullpen strain heighten upset risk in this AL East matchup.

This market will resolve to "Toronto Blue Jays" if the Toronto Blue Jays win the game.
This market will resolve to "Tampa Bay Rays" if the Tampa Bay Rays win the game.
If the game is postponed, this market will remain open until the game has been completed. If the game is canceled entirely, with no make-up game, or ends in a tie, this market will resolve 50-50.
The primary resolution source for this market is the official final statistics of the event as recognized by the governing body or event organizers. However, if the governing body or event organizers have not published final match statistics within 24 hours after the event's conclusion, a consensus of credible reporting may be used instead.
